I am using Chrome but I miss the old Opera gestures (specifically right click + left click for back and LC + RC for forward). I have tried the following extensions, and although they offer some nice alternatives, it's not quite what I am looking for.

This is what I tried:

  • Chrome Mouse Gesture
  • Smooth Gestures
  • Gestures For Chrome(TM)

Does anyone know of a way (preferably an extension) that has the RC + LC gesture functionality?

Thanks.

Smooth Gestures seems to provide this functionality by default.

enter image description here

There are some limitations though. One thing I noticed is, once you've gone all the way back in history to the new tab page, you can't move forward again, as the extension can't run on that page. Similarly, the extension also can't run in the Chrome Web Store for example.

I don't know how problematic that is in real-world use though.
